LOYTEC LVIS-3ME ICSA-17-257-01 Multiple Security Vulnerabilities

LOYTEC LVIS-3ME is prone to the following security vulnerabilities: :

1. A directory-traversal vulnerability
2. An insufficient-entropy vulnerability
3. A cross-site scripting vulnerability
4. An information-disclosure vulnerability

An attacker may leverage these issues to execute script code in the browser of an unsuspecting user in the context of the affected site, disclose sensitive information, execute arbitrary code within the context of the affected system or use specially crafted requests with directory-traversal sequences ('../') to read arbitrary files in the context of the application.

Versions prior to LVIS-3ME 6.2.0 are vulnerable.
